ISB0 - 2 — These three input current status pins are used for
top/bottom pulse width correction in complementary channel
operation for PWMB.
Port D GPIO — These GPIO pins can be individually
programmed as input or output pins.
At reset, these pins default to ISB functionality.
To deactivate the internal pull-up resistor, clear the appropriate
bit of the GPIOD_PUR register. For details, see Part 6.5.8.

FAULTB0 - 3 — These four fault input pins are used for
disabling selected PWMB outputs in cases where fault
conditions originate off-chip.
To deactivate the internal pull-up resistor, set the PWMB bit in
the SIM_PUDR register. For details, see Part 6.5.8.
